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Foundation: Different foundation types, such as slab, crawl space, or basement, can impact the cost.
- Extent of Damage: Minor cracks versus significant structural damage will have different repair costs.
- Soil Conditions: The type of soil and its stability in Knoxville can affect the complexity and cost of the repair.
- Accessibility: Hard-to-reach areas or obstacles can increase labor costs.
- Repair Method: The chosen method for repair, such as steel piers, helical piers, or concrete piers, can vary in cost.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all cost.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Knoxville, TN) |
---|---|
Initial Inspection | $200 - $500 |
Soil Testing | $500 - $1,000 |
Steel Pier Installation | $1,000 - $1,500 per pier |
Helical Pier Installation | $1,200 - $2,000 per pier |
Concrete Pier Installation | $800 - $1,200 per pier |
Crack Repair | $500 - $1,000 per crack |
Waterproofing |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Structural Reinforcement | $2,000 - $5,000 |
Permit and Inspection Fees | $100 - $300 |
